Viewers think the I’m A Celebrity 2024 winner is already set, as they discussed their votes hours before the final.

Fans of the ITV series predicted who would win the jungle show hosted by Ant McPartlin and Dec Donnelly. Coleen Rooney, Danny Jones and Reverend Richard Coles are the three finalists, after Oti Mabuse left the jungle on Saturday night.

On Sunday night one of them will be crowned the new King or Queen of the Jungle, taking 2023 winner Sam Thompson’s victory. The trio will be rejoined by the former campmates who didn’t make the final, while Tulisa Contostavlos will not appear.

Now, with just hours to go, some viewers believe the winner is “obvious” and that one star “must win”. Despite voting not yet closed and the announcement not being made until this evening, fans think that one campmate will definitely be crowned the champion.

Coleen is tipped to win the series, amid her husband Wayne Rooney and their kids sharing their support. With Wayne hoping his wife brings home the crown, viewers do too with many fans of the show believing she will be the person declared victorious on Sunday evening.

Taking to social media, one viewer said: “Coleen has to win,” as another wrote: “Coleen has won.” A third fan posted on X: “I voted for Coleen to win the whole competition. We ladies have to stick together.”

A fourth fan posted online: “Coleen must win. She has to,” as another said: “Coleen to take the win.” A further comment read: “Coleen should win,” while one viewer theorised: “Absolutely rigged for Coleen to win.”

Hosts Ant and Dec had already addressed fix claims just days ago, after former star GK Barry made a comment in her exit chat. When the presenters asked her who she thought would win, she shared her hopes that Richard would be the champion – while she also said she’d be happy if Coleen won.

But when she spoke about Richard being the potential winner, she suggested that if this did not happen then the show and the vote was “fixed”. Ant and Dec were quick to react with Ant calling this idea out.

Ant screamed out: “No… how would it be a fix? People vote,” as he pointed to the cameras. GK claimed that for her pal not to win would suggest the voting was fixed, while the conversation soon moved on.
